Stronger Warnings for Bowel Cleansing Agents (April 2009)
FDA is announcing new safety measures for oral sodium phosphate (OSP) products used for bowel cleansing before colonoscopies and other procedures. These products are associated with acute phosphate nephropathy, a rare but serious type of kidney injury. The events have … Continue reading

Renal Failure Associated with Bowel Cleansing Agents
FDA is notifying healthcare professionals about an association between oral sodium phosphates (osps) for bowel cleansing and a type of acute renal failure called acute phosphate nephropathy. These occurrences, which are rare but serious, have been associated with both OSP … Continue reading
